Prominent asset management firms Point72 and ExodusPoint disclose holding Alt5 Sigma shares
BlockBeats News, August 20th, according to Bloomberg, ExodusPoint Capital Management and Steve Cohen's asset management firm Point72 disclosed their holdings in Alt5 Sigma this Monday, with Point72 holding 4% valued at approximately $26.7 million and ExodusPoint's main fund holding over 5% at one point, currently at 4.75%, with a position value of approximately $32.1 million.
On August 11th, ALT5 Sigma announced that it has entered into agreements to sell 2 billion common shares at a price of $7.50 per share through a registered direct offering and concurrent private placement, raising a total of $1.5 billion. World Liberty Financial is the main investor in this private placement.
Point72 Asset Management is a globally renowned alternative investment firm headquartered in Stamford, Connecticut, USA. As of July 1, 2025, its assets under management are approximately $39.9 billion.
